Organization and maintenance of images using metadata
First Claim
1. A method for storing electronic image file data, comprising:
- generating images with an imaging device having wireless communication capability, each image being stored as an image file;
assigning metadata to each image file contemporaneously with generation of each image, the metadata categorizing each image according to at least two schemes;
wirelessly transmitting the image files and assigned metadata from the imaging device for storage on a second device such that the image files may subsequently be searched based upon the metadata.
2 Assignments
0 Petitions
Accused Products
Abstract
Data for electronic images is stored in a server. Metadata is assigned to each image file and categorizes each image according to one or more schemes. Possible metadata schemes include image date, one or more image subjects, and image location. The image files may then be searched based on the assigned metadata. Images may be stored in a database that includes at least one virtual folder corresponding to each metadata scheme, with each image having at least one entry in each folder. Each folder may further have subfolders that correspond to sub-categories of a categorization scheme. Each image may then have an entry in each subfolder which describes a part of the image metadata. A date search interface allows a user to select a year of interest, then a month, and then a day. A location search interface allows a user to select a subregion of a displayed region.
311 Citations
53 Claims
-
1. A method for storing electronic image file data, comprising:
-
generating images with an imaging device having wireless communication capability, each image being stored as an image file;
assigning metadata to each image file contemporaneously with generation of each image, the metadata categorizing each image according to at least two schemes;
wirelessly transmitting the image files and assigned metadata from the imaging device for storage on a second device such that the image files may subsequently be searched based upon the metadata.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13)
-
-
14. A server for storing image data, comprising:
-
a memory;
a communications interface coupled to a wireless communication network; and
a processor configured to perform steps comprising;
storing, in the memory, images transmitted through the wireless communication network to the server, each image having associated metadata categorizing said image according to at least two schemes, wherein said at least two schemes include at least one of an image date, an image location and one or more image subjects, and the images are stored in a database at the memory, the database including at least one virtual folder corresponding to each of the at least two metadata schemes. - View Dependent Claims (15, 16, 17, 18, 19, 20, 21, 22, 23, 24, 25, 26, 27, 28, 29, 30, 31, 32, 33, 34, 35, 36, 37)
-
-
38. A wireless mobile device, comprising:
-
a camera;
a user interface;
a communication interface with a wireless communication network; and
a processor configured to perform steps comprising;
generating image files for images created with the camera, assigning metadata to each image file contemporaneously with generation of each image, the metadata categorizing each image according to at least two schemes, and transmitting the image files and assigned metadata, via the wireless communication network, for storage at a remote location such that the image files may subsequently be searched based upon the metadata. - View Dependent Claims (39, 40, 41, 42, 43, 44, 45, 46, 47)
-
-
48. A machine-readable medium having machine-executable instructions for performing steps comprising:
storing images transmitted through a wireless communication network to a server, each image having associated metadata categorizing said image according to at least two schemes, wherein said at least two schemes include at least one of image date, an image location and one or more image subjects, and the images are stored in a database having at least one virtual folder corresponding to each of the at least two metadata schemes. - View Dependent Claims (49, 50, 51, 52)
-
53. A system for storing images, comprising:
-
a wireless mobile device, including;
a digital camera, a user interface, a communication interface with a wireless communication network, and a processor configured to perform steps comprising;
generating image files for images created with the digital camera, generating a prompt for a user to accept or modify a suggested subject for an image based upon data in another application program being executed by the processor, obtaining location data from a base station for the wireless network, assigning metadata to each image file contemporaneously with generation of each image, the metadata categorizing each image according to a first scheme comprising date of image creation, according to a second scheme comprising multiple subjects shown in an image, and according to a third scheme comprising location of image creation, and transmitting the image files and assigned metadata, via the wireless communication network, for storage at a remote location such that the image files may subsequently be searched based upon the metadata; and
a server for storing image data, comprising;
a memory, a communications interface coupled to the wireless communication network, and a processor configured to perform steps comprising;
storing images generated by the wireless mobile device and transmitted through the wireless communication network to the server, said storing comprising storing the images in a database in the memory, the database having at least one virtual folder corresponding to each metadata scheme, and wherein each image has at least one entry in each of the at least one folders, providing a user interface to select a year, displaying, as part of the user interface to select a year, an indication of the years for which there are stored images having metadata indicating creation of an image in an indicated year, providing a user interface to select a month of the selected year, displaying, as part of the user interface to select a month, an indication of the months for which there are stored images having metadata indicating creation of an image in an indicated month, providing a user interface to select a day of the selected month, displaying, as part of the user interface to select a day, an indication of the days for which there are stored images having metadata indicating creation of an image on an indicated day, displaying, upon selection of a day, information regarding images created on the selected day, providing a user interface to select a subregion of a displayed region, displaying, as part of the user interface to select a subregion, an indication of the subregions for which there are stored images having metadata indicating creation of an image in an indicated subregion, displaying, upon selection of a subregion, information regarding images created in the selected subregion, and identifying, after selection of an image by a user, other images having metadata in common with the selected image, wherein the common metadata is metadata other than the metadata utilized to initially search for the selected image.
-
Specification